Juan decided to start savings for college. He deposited $500 into an account which earns 4% simple annual interest. At the end of each year, he will add $250 to this account. How much will he have in his account after the end of three years? a $550 b $770 c $1,050.80 d $1,342.83 Belle decided to start a new investment account. She deposits $1,000 into an account that earns 3.5% interest, compounded quarterly for 10 years. How much more would she have earned, in interest, if she invested the same amount into an account earning 3.8% interest, compounded monthly, for the same number of years? a $44.50 b $350 c $1,416.91 d 1,461.41
